Here are seven innovative strategies for agile project management success:
Embrace change: Agile project management recognises that change is inevitable and encourages teams to embrace it rather than resist it. By remaining flexible and open to new ideas, teams can adapt quickly to changing requirements and deliver value to customers.
Collaborate with stakeholders: Agile project management emphasises the importance of collaboration between team members and stakeholders. By involving stakeholders early and often in the project process, teams can ensure alignment on project goals and expectations.
Prioritise work: Agile project management encourages teams to focus on delivering high-value work first. By prioritising work based on customer needs and business value, teams can maximise the impact of their efforts and deliver value early and often.
Break work into small increments: Agile project management advocates for breaking work into small, manageable increments. By delivering work in short iterations, teams can quickly gather feedback and make necessary adjustments to ensure project success.
Foster a culture of continuous improvement: Agile project management promotes a culture of continuous improvement, where teams reflect on their processes and make adjustments to improve efficiency and effectiveness. By fostering a culture of learning and experimentation, teams can continuously evolve and deliver better results.
Empower the team: Agile project management empowers teams to make decisions and take ownership of their work. By trusting team members to make decisions and solve problems, teams can increase their autonomy and motivation, leading to better project outcomes.
Measure progress and adapt: Agile project management encourages teams to measure progress and adapt their approach based on feedback. By regularly reviewing progress and adjusting plans as needed, teams can ensure they are on track to deliver successful projects.
